Output c7345686026e9b27c390af29ebc8c424aa4c5a3033fb5c1bfaecd21e575e5144:1

value
32061232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c3abf498c24e2807618dde289b63cb2de21397 OP_EQUAL
address
34mYdP8Gi3wwpsLqizrumwgSLBncVqhAx3
transaction
c7345686026e9b27c390af29ebc8c424aa4c5a3033fb5c1bfaecd21e575e5144
spent
true